Why it matters

Why this market is hard for AI to trust

The data highlights specific technical barriers preventing Denver movers from appearing in AI responses. A major issue is the prevalence of weak answer blocks, affecting 75% of the companies scanned. When your website lacks structured, direct responses to common moving questions, AI models skip over your business. Furthermore, 38% of local movers are inadvertently blocking 11 different AI crawlers from accessing their site content. This technical lockout means even if you offer the best packing or heavy item handling in Colorado, the technology responsible for modern discovery cannot verify your services. Additionally, 50% of analyzed sites have incorrect title tag lengths, which muddies the clarity of your local service offerings. Addressing these gaps is essential for maintaining a presence in a digital landscape that rewards accessible, verifiable data.

FAQ

Common questions from this market

How can we ensure AI identifies our specific Denver service areas?

You must use structured text to list every suburb and neighborhood you serve, from Arvada to Aurora. Avoid vague descriptions; explicitly name the municipalities to help AI map your reach accurately.

How do we make our online moving quotes more trustworthy to AI?

Include detailed, transparent breakdown components in your website text. Providing specific details about how you calculate weight, distance, and labor costs helps AI verify the legitimacy of your pricing structure.

What details are necessary for AI to recommend our specialty packing services?

Move beyond generic terms. Detail your specific offerings, such as heavy item handling, fragile crate packing, or climate-controlled storage. Granular detail allows AI to match your specific capabilities with niche customer requests.

Why is my website's metadata affecting my local visibility?

Incorrect title tag lengths can prevent search engines from correctly categorizing your local services. Standardizing this data ensures that when someone searches for 'Denver movers,' your specific business type is correctly identified.

How can we prevent AI crawlers from ignoring our service updates?

Check your robots.txt file to ensure you are not accidentally blocking the 11 identified AI crawlers. If these bots cannot access your site, they cannot pull your latest pricing or service availability.
